Output 8dbce284d8d2b6ce5bc4b5423a8a22322fce89c0aab2e43d1178e5400de0b14b:0

value
72307015542
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9aa743f6c126a62aa8741a3f2a96c2142111dbaa240bde456c018d8976e8cf30
address
tb1pn2n58akpy6nz42r5rglj49kzzss3rka2ys9au3tvqxxcjahgeucqvhvuy8
transaction
8dbce284d8d2b6ce5bc4b5423a8a22322fce89c0aab2e43d1178e5400de0b14b
confirmations
65616
spent
true